ECP Passenger Cable-Based Braking System—Performance Requirements

Abstract

This standard contains the minimum performance requirements for electronically controlled pneumatic (ECP) brake systems operating on passenger cars that are part of the general railroad system.

Summary

Use a hazard management approach to set standards and minimum requirements for a passenger railroad’s gap safety management program. The approach should include the following key elements:
  • Develop and implement a hazard management program that supports decisions on setting and maintaining nominal gap requirements.
  • Develop and implement visual and audible public awareness programs that communicate information about the railroad’s gap.
  • Develop and implement a training component for on-board railroad personnel in regard to their role in maintaining passenger safety while traversing the gap.
  • Implement inspection procedures to monitor station platform conditions.
  • Verify that maintenance procedures for track and vehicles maintain the system’s nominal gap as required by the railroad.
  • Develop and implement a training component for maintenance and construction personnel as necessary.
